5 Hints to get Started

1. Search for a Program to find the institutions that offer courses you need.

2.Read the online Directory descriptions and the university’s main website very carefully.

3. Ask friend who already went abroad.

4. Plan carefully, but be flexible. Precise information about courses may not be available until shortly before your program begins, so be sure to have alternate courses in mind.

5.Consider non-traditional destinations. You may have the opportunity later in life to go on a European tour or cruise south of the border, but this will be your one chance to spend a year or semester somewhere unique like Finland, Korea, Ghana, or Uruguay.  Besides, it will look terrific on your resume!
